Transaction 20c944e0319fabb76eae6fe392f599700ae60fc24a9b76a66a03028ef4da64e8
1 Input
1 Output
-
20c944e0319fabb76eae6fe392f599700ae60fc24a9b76a66a03028ef4da64e8:0
- value
- 512317
- script pubkey
- OP_0 OP_PUSHBYTES_20 de46f5bbe6dcd1390285b117e78cb2829031891f
- address
- bc1qmer0twlxmngnjq59kyt70r9js2grrzgldk6qj5